WebAug 9, 2024 · The S1W prototype was constructed in support of the world’s first nuclear-powered submarine, USS NAUTILUS. This land-based reactor was built inside a prototypic section of a submarine hull at the NRF on the Arco Desert west of Idaho Falls. WebJul 2, 2016 · The second prototype core (S1W-3) operated between March 1956 and November 1957. The first NAUTILUS core (S1W-2) operated from December 1954 until February 1957. The second NAUTILUS core (S1W-3A) operated between April 1957 and May 1959. WebThe S1W was a pressurized water reactor that utilized water as the coolant and neutron moderator in its primary system, and enriched Uranium-235 in its fuel elements. The S1W reactor reached criticality on March 30, 1953. In May of that year, it began power operations, performing a 100 hour run that simulated a submerged voyage from the east ...
